PhD Bioinformatics is a research-based doctoral program of 3 - 4 years duration that is a combination of biology and computer science. It is an analysis of biological data, applying different algorithms and creating computational tools for biological studies.Applicants with an MSc in Bioinformatics or a comparable subject are qualified to join the course. Admissions are done through entrance tests, and some of them are CSIR NET, SET, GATE, etc.
The fees for the course differ between government and private colleges. Private colleges charge up to INR 3 to 5 Lakhs for the whole course, while government colleges charge up to INR 40,000 to 50,000, including central facility charges and registration fees. Government agencies also provide fellowships and other grants to PhD candidates.
After gaining a PhD in Bioinformatics, an individual can obtain a job as a scientist, research associate, assistant professor, or project associate in any research institute. The initial salary for the holder of a PhD may be between INR 4 to 7 LPA.

What is Ph D Bioinformatics?
A PhD in Bioinformatics is a research program where students learn how to use computers to study biology. It mainly focuses on collecting and analyzing data about genes, proteins, and other parts of living things. The course brings together biology and computer science, helping students understand life processes in a smarter and faster way.
During the course, students explore how computers can help in finding new medicines, studying diseases, and understanding how living things work at a deeper level. They learn skills like handling big sets of biological data, using software tools, and solving health-related problems. In the end, it prepares them for careers in research, medicine, and biotechnology.

PhD Bioinformatics Eligibility
Given below is the detailed eligibility criteria for the Ph.D Bioinformatics course. Student must meet a certain criteria in order to pursue the course:
- Candidates must hold a master’s degree in the relevant field such as MSc/MTech in Bioinformatics with a minimum of 55% marks from a recognized university.
- Candidates with backgrounds like Maths, Computer Science, Biostatistics, or any Life Science majors can apply.
- The admission is strictly based on the entrance exam scores of the candidates. Students need to have a valid score in entrances such as UGC NET/UGC CSIR NET/GATE etc.

PhD Bioinformatics Admission Process
PhD in Bioinformatics admission is based on cut-off marks scored in the entrance exam. Some common entrance exams are UGC NET, SET, CSIR-UGC NET, GATE, and DBT.
Some universities also conduct their own entrance test and subsequent interview rounds.
Given below is the step by step admission process for the IIT Hyderabad for your reference:
Step 1: Go to the IIT Hyderabad PhD admissions page and the Dept. of Biotechnology site to check the current call (IITH usually admits in Jan/Jul cycles).
Step 2: Check eligibility + valid exam scores: You should have one of these:
- MTech in Life/Biotech/Physical Sciences
OR
- MSc in Allied Life/Physical/Chemical Sciences with a valid GATE or a National-level JRF; OR
- BTech/BE/MBBS with GATE or a valid National-level JRF.
- Accepted JRFs include CSIR-NET-JRF, UGC-NET-JRF, ICMR-JRF, DBT-JRF (Cat-I), DST-INSPIRE. Also note the department’s minimum marks cut-offs.
Step 3: Fill the application form on the IITH PhD admissions portal, upload transcripts, CV, scorecards (GATE/JRF), category certificate (if any), and a brief research statement aligned to computational biology/bioinformatics.
Step 4: The department shortlists based on its criteria (often higher than the minimum). Only shortlisted candidates are called further.
Step 5: Selection is primarily via interviews conducted by the department. If a written test is scheduled, they will inform you—prepare the basics of bioinformatics, statistics, and research methods.
Step 6: If selected, you’ll get a provisional offer under either Institute Fellowship (MoE) or External Fellowship (if you hold CSIR/UGC/ICMR/DBT/INSPIRE, etc.). Complete document verification as instructed.
Step 7: Pay fees, complete registration, and finalize your supervisor. For bioinformatics-focused work, explore faculty working on computational genomics, AI for precision medicine, biomolecular modeling, multi-omics, chemoinformatics, etc., listed in the department brochure
PhD Bioinformatics Syllabus
A PhD in Bioinformatics is a research-based program focused on in-silico analysis and thesis writing. Therefore, there is no defined syllabus for it. The coursework includes some theoretical aspects of research, depending on the individual’s research requirement, university policies, and UGC recommendations.
Also, students must present their progress yearly in front of the Research/Doctoral Advisory Committee. They also have to face a viva as the final assessment.

PhD Bioinformatics FAQs
Is it compulsory to do an M.Phil before PhD in Bioinformatics?
No, M.Phil is not required for admission to a PhD in Bioinformatics. One can qualify for state or national-level entrance exams with a valid score and can register for the course. Candidates with an M.Phil qualification may be exempted from the entrance exam conducted by the university.
How many paper publications are required to complete a PhD?
As per the latest UGC guidelines, paper publication is not a compulsion. Some universities are still following the previous guidelines where a minimum of 2 research papers were required to complete the PhD. Also, it does not count review papers, book chapters, or conference proceedings.
Are academic duties compulsory for PhD in Bioinformatics aspirants?
Yes, UGC guidelines for PhD programs have marked it as a compulsion for every PhD aspirant, irrespective of their funding agencies and university policies. This includes teaching the UG or PG students, monitoring their progress and assessments, assisting the supervisor in conducting exams/viva/training, etc.
